Volcanoes!

Presented By: Australian Museum

Date: 26 May 2010

Venue: Sydney Olympic Park

Location: 28


Primary School Program

Activity Type: Workshop
Duration: 60 minutes
Times: 09:30 AM  10:45 AM  12:00 PM 
Capacity: 25 students

What exactly is a volcano? Find out about the Earth’s interior, how volcanoes form, where they are found, what causes eruptions and what volcanoes can tell us about our planet’s movement through time. Students are able to enjoy a simulated volcanic eruption!
